Job Description

As a Talent Recruiter Selection youll lead the interview and selection process for instructional hiring across six middle schools and two high schools in Newark ensuring candidates have a high-quality experience and school leaders are supported every step of the way. In this role you will partner closely with an Outreach Recruiter who owns top-of-funnel sourcing while you focus on screening interview coordination candidate engagement and school leader collaboration. You will serve as a trusted advisor to school teams and play a critical role in helping Uncommon build diverse high-performing instructional teams.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

SELECTION STRATEGY & EXECUTION

  • Manage candidate assessment communications and progress from application through offer
  • Conduct resume reviews and phone interviews to assess candidate fit and alignment
  • Coordinate and facilitate both virtual and in-person interviews in partnership with school teams
  • Collaborate with 8 school leaders and regional superintendents to ensure smooth timely and effective hiring processes
  • Ensure consistent and positive candidate experiences that reflect Uncommons values and culture

SCHOOL LEADER PARTNERSHIP

  • Partner with Principals and Regional Superintendents to identify hiring priorities define selection processes and maintain alignment
  • Serve as the main point of contact for selection logistics and decisions
  • Equip school leaders with tools data and support to move high-potential candidates through the funnel efficiently

CROSS-FUNCTIONAL COLLABORATION

  • Work closely with the Outreach Recruiter to align on candidate handoffs funnel health and hiring timelines
  • Partner on recruitment events and strategies targeting Newark middle and high school instructional talent
  • Collaborate with regional and network teams on shared projects that improve selection systems tools and candidate experience

DATA & SYSTEMS

  • Maintain accurate candidate records in our Applicant Tracking System (ATS)
  • Monitor hiring funnel metrics and use data to identify process improvements and trends
  • Provide regular updates and insights to school and regional leaders

Qualifications :

  • Bachelors degree or equivalent experience required
  • 34 years of professional experience with at least 12 years in recruitment or K12 school-based roles
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ail
  • Comfort working with recruitment tools and systems to track progress and make data-informed decisions
  • High level of initiative flexibility and ability to manage shifting priorities
  • Commitment to educational equity and to Uncommons mission of serving historically underserved communities

Compensation

The starting pay will most likely be $67300 to $71300. The full range for this role is between $67300 and $79200 but the starting pay will depend on various factors including relevant professional experience education certifications and tenure with Uncommon Schools. To receive an offer at the top of the range candidates will need significant experience beyond the job description requirements. Because we value staff tenure in a role we do not currently cap salary ranges for current staff members. 

Benefits

  • 19 days of paid time off
  • 3 weeks of paid Winter and Summer org-wide holidays
  • Comprehensive Health Dental and Vision insurance plans
  • 403(b) retirement savings program employer match
  • Paid leave of absence options (parental medical disability etc.)
  • Mental health and counseling support wellness benefits
  • Pre-tax flexible spending dependent care and health saving accounts
